Convert microliter to gill (UK)

Please provide values below to convert microliter [µL] to gill (UK) [gi (UK)], or Convert gill (UK) to microliter.

1 µL = 7.0390159208e-06 gi (UK). To convert microliter to gill (UK), multiply the value by 7.0390159208e-06; to go the other way, divide by it (1 gi (UK) = 142065.313 µL). Microliter

A microliter (µL) is a unit of volume equal to one millionth of a liter, or 10^-6 liters.

History/Origin

The microliter was introduced as part of the metric system to facilitate precise measurement in scientific and medical fields, especially with the advent of micro-scale laboratory techniques.

Current Use

Microliters are commonly used in laboratories for measuring small liquid volumes, such as in chemistry, biology, and medical diagnostics, often in conjunction with micropipettes and microfluidic devices.


Gill (Uk)

A gill (UK) is a unit of volume equal to one-quarter of a pint, primarily used for measuring liquids such as spirits and milk.

History/Origin

The UK gill originated in the 19th century as part of the imperial measurement system, traditionally used in British households and trade for liquid measurements before metrication.

Current Use

Today, the UK gill is largely obsolete and rarely used in everyday measurements, but it may still be encountered in historical contexts, recipes, or specific legal or traditional settings.
